It was a rich brown in colour and in the sunlight its metallic armour shone in a dazzling splendour.

Neewa, squatted flat on his belly, eyed it with a swiftly beating heart.

The beetle was not more than a foot away, and ADVANCING! That was the curious and rather shocking part of it.

It was the first living thing he had met with that day that had not run away.
As it advanced slowly on its two rows of legs the beetle made a clicking sound that Neewa heard quite distinctly.

With the fighting blood of his father, Soominitik, nerving him on to the adventure he thrust out a hesitating paw, and instantly Chegawasse, the beetle, took upon himself a most ferocious aspect.
